Once upon a time, in a small village, there lived a young woman named Lily. She was known for her beauty, but she had a flaw that consumed her thoughts - she could never truly love herself. One day, Lily came across a mysterious mirror tucked away in the attic of her grandmother's house. As she gazed into it, she saw a reflection that shocked her. It was not her physical appearance she saw, but rather her inner self - her insecurities, doubts, and fears all reflected back at her. Disturbed by what she saw, Lily decided to confront the mirror. Slowly, she started to recognize that her self-perception was skewed by her own judgment and the expectations of others. She realized that true beauty lies not in what others think of us, but in how we embrace and love ourselves. From that day forward, Lily began a journey of self-acceptance and self-love. She learned to treat herself with kindness, to celebrate her strengths, and to accept her imperfections. The mirror, once a source of distress, became a reminder of her growth and self-awareness. Lily's newfound self-love radiated from within, attracting those who were captivated by her authentic beauty. The lesson of the mirror of self-love is simple yet profound - it is only through embracing our true selves, flaws and all, that we can truly love and be loved.
